Why Blackjack Remains a Player Favorite

Blackjack, often called 21, has stood the test of time as one of the most popular casino games worldwide. But what makes it so enduringly appealing to players of all skill levels?

1. Simplicity Meets Strategy
Blackjack is easy to learn, making it accessible for beginners. Players quickly grasp the goal: get as close to 21 as possible without going over. However, beneath this simplicity lies a strategic depth that attracts experienced players. Deciding when to hit, stand, split, or double down adds a level of skill that many casino games lack.

2. Low House Edge
Compared to other casino games, blackjack offers one of the lowest house edges. This means that with proper strategy, players have a higher chance of walking away with winnings. The combination of strategy and favorable odds keeps players coming back.

3. Fast-Paced and Exciting
The quick rounds and constant decision-making make blackjack thrilling. Every hand is different, and the outcome depends not only on luck but also on the choices players make, creating an engaging mix of suspense and control.

4. Social Interaction
Unlike many other casino games, blackjack is often played at a table with other people. Players can interact, share strategies, and celebrate wins together, enhancing the social aspect of the game.

5. Versatility
Blackjack is available in various formats, from traditional land-based tables to live dealer and online versions. With countless variations and betting options, players can find a version that suits their style and budget.

Conclusion
Blackjack remains a favorite because it perfectly balances simplicity, strategy, and excitement. Whether you’re a casual player or a seasoned strategist, its combination of skill, low house edge, and social interaction ensures it stays a staple in casinos worldwide.
